Do Cerebral Palsy and Cognitive Development Intersect in Children?

Cerebral palsy (CP) is a group of neurological disorders caused by non-progressive brain injuries that occur before, during, or shortly after birth. While the primary hallmark of CP is motor dysfunction—such as impaired movement, coordination, and posture—many parents and caregivers wonder whether it also affects cognitive abilities. The answer is not uniform: while some children with cerebral palsy have average or above-average intelligence, others may experience varying degrees of intellectual disability.

Understanding the Link Between Cerebral Palsy and Intellectual Function

The brain damage that leads to cerebral palsy can sometimes affect areas responsible for cognitive processing, memory, learning, and language development. When the injury involves critical regions of the cerebral cortex—especially those governing higher-order thinking—children may exhibit delays or deficits in intellectual functioning. These impairments can manifest as difficulties with problem-solving, attention span, information retention, or verbal communication.

In more severe cases, especially when brain damage is widespread, children may display symptoms resembling developmental delay or even intellectual disability. However, it's important to note that these outcomes are not universal. Many children with cerebral palsy possess normal intelligence but face challenges primarily in physical expression, which can be mistaken for cognitive impairment.

Factors Influencing Cognitive Outcomes

The presence and severity of intellectual challenges often correlate with the extent and location of brain injury. For instance, children with spastic quadriplegia—a more severe form of CP affecting all four limbs—are more likely to experience cognitive delays than those with milder forms like hemiplegia. Additionally, associated conditions such as epilepsy, hearing or vision impairments, and speech disorders can further complicate the assessment of a child's true intellectual potential.

The Importance of Early and Comprehensive Assessment

Early intervention is key to maximizing a child's developmental trajectory. Regular multidisciplinary evaluations—including neurodevelopmental screenings, psychological testing, and educational assessments—are essential for identifying cognitive strengths and areas needing support. Tools such as MRI scans and EEGs help clinicians pinpoint structural or functional abnormalities in the brain, offering valuable insights into both the diagnosis of cerebral palsy and the presence of co-occurring intellectual challenges.

These assessments allow healthcare providers to create individualized care plans that address not only motor skills but also cognitive, emotional, and social development. Speech therapy, occupational therapy, special education programs, and assistive technologies play vital roles in helping children reach their full potential.

Supporting Cognitive Growth in Children with CP

Families and educators should focus on creating stimulating environments that encourage exploration, communication, and learning. With appropriate support, many children with cerebral palsy excel academically and socially, proving that physical limitations do not define intellectual capacity. Recognizing each child's unique abilities and providing tailored interventions can make a significant difference in long-term outcomes.

In conclusion, while cerebral palsy can impact cognitive function in some children, it does not inherently equate to intellectual disability. A proactive, holistic approach to evaluation and treatment ensures that every child receives the tools they need to thrive—both mentally and physically.
